Ingredients

for
4
Ingredients
150 grams honeydew melon
300 grams Cantaloupe
1 Tbsp lemon juice
1 Tbsp dry white wine
0.3 gram Saffron
2 Tbsps Raspberry syrup
1 Tbsp powdered sugar

Preparation steps

1.

Peel melons, scoop out seeds and cut the flesh into 1 cm (approximately 1/2 inch) cubes. Puree half of the canteloupe finely and mix with the lemon juice, wine and saffron.

2.

Dip the edges of 4 glasses in raspberry syrup and then roll in powdered sugar. Add the remaining melon cubes to the glasses and serve drizzled with the melon puree.
